That's Eric Gillis'(mksupra) roadster:


Good people of the Group!
I have no idea how this weighs in on the current discussion of Roadster market
value, but I did want pass along that the mighty Roadster has scored a class
win at this year's Monterey Concours d'Lemons!
A trophy of a stuffed bass (sushi in the raw), and plaque from the
'Soul-Sucking Japanese Appliance' class were awarded! Bribes were tough, as
many of the judges were still nursing hangovers from the party the night
before, however shrewd planning (I brought Datsun Roadster tees) and well
placed personal compliments to the judges delivered where sake and SaveMart
sushi failed! http://www.pbase.com/egillis/image/127566924" onclick="window.open(this.href);return false;" onclick="window.open(this.href);return false;
'Worst of Show' was the most awesome 'shortened' VW bus that entertained the
crowd with wheelies in the parking lot, The car was 'sectioned' lengthwise to
remove the side door and put back together. The wheel base length, well, let's
call it short... http://www.pbase.com/egillis/image/127566922" onclick="window.open(this.href);return false;" onclick="window.open(this.href);return false;
Enjoy your ride!
Eric G
